A Difficult Woman is an Australian television series which screened in 1998 on the ABC. The four part series starred Caroline Goodall, in the title role of a woman whose best friend is murdered and is determined to find out why.{{Citation | last= Tabakoff | first= Jenny | title= Not the usual suspects | url= | periodical= The Sydney Morning Herald | date= 12 October 1998 }} It was written by Nicholas Hammond and Steven Vidler and directed by Tony Tilse.{{Cite web|url=http://www.australiantelevision.net/telemovies/1998.html|title = Australian Television: Telemovies and Miniseries: 1998}} Simon Hughes of the Age wrote "That is the quibble about A Difficult Woman. That in seeking to cover all bases, it overeggs the pudding. For all that, it is impressive."{{Citation | last= Hughes | first= Simon | title= Psychology, not murder, on the mind | url= | periodical= The Age | date= 12 October 1998 }}
